Narail: A three-day Shilpakala Academy Utshab-2025 commenced today at the Narail Zila Shilpakala Academy, bringing together artists and cultural enthusiasts. The event was inaugurated by Additional Deputy Commissioner (education and ICT) Md Ahsan Mahmud Russel, who attended as the chief guest. The ceremony was presided over by Bangladesh Shilpakala Academy Director (Fine Arts) Mustafa Zaman.
According to Bangladesh Sangbad Sangstha, the inaugural function was graced by several notable figures, including former Khulna University Fine Arts Department teacher Professor Bimanesh Biswas, district cultural officer Abdul Rakibil Bari, and Sultan Smriti Sanggrahashala Curator Tandra Mukharjee. Artists such as Boldeb Adhikari, Nikhil Chandra Das, Mahbub Jamal Shamim, Sadi Taief, Mehedi Hasan Rana, Samir Majumder, and Sourav Banerjee were also in attendance, contributing to the event’s significance.
In a gesture of respect, participants paid tribute to the late eminent artist SM Sultan by placing a wreath on his grave. The festival will continue with a workshop scheduled for tomorrow, and on February 28, attendees can look forward to a puppet show and another workshop. Additionally, a seminar focusing on the life and works of SM Sultan is slated for the evening of February 28, offering deeper insights into his contributions to the art world.
